IMS Luxembourg, in partnership with the Ministry of Agriculture, Food and Viticulture, is launching The Good Fork – a new award dedicated to collective catering operators and food sector organisations committed to more responsible food practices.
Open to all organisations, regardless off their size or sector of activity, the award recognises initiatives led by those who provide collective meals or are committed to promotions more sustainable food systems.
This first edition will highlight concrete and inspiring practices across two thèmes:
- Fight against food waste
- Supply of regional and seasonal products
Applications are open from now until 16 February 2026.
Twelve initiatives will be shortlisted and presented at an award ceremony on 17 March 2026, where the audience will select the winners of the People's Vote Project - The Good Fork 2026. The winners will receive a promotional video of their initiative and media visibility.
All collected practices will be featured in a Best Practices Guide co-published by IMS Luxembourg and the Ministry of Agriculture, Food and Viticulture, to inspire and encourage the transition towards a more sustainable food system.
